053/**
054 * This class defines an API that may be used to create a specific type of
055 * scripted error logger which is intended to write log messages to text files.
056 * This is a convenience for developers which wish to create custom error
057 * loggers that write to text files and provides support for a wide range of
058 * functionality including high-performance and highly-concurrent logging.  All
059 * of the options available to {@link ScriptedErrorLogger} implementations are
060 * available for file-based error loggers, as well as options for indicating
061 * the log file path, the rotation and retention policies, whether to buffer the
062 * output, etc.
063 * <BR><BR>
064 * Note that scripted file-based error loggers will automatically be registered
065 * within the server as disk space consumers, so there is no need to implement
066 * the {@link com.unboundid.directory.sdk.common.api.DiskSpaceConsumer}
067 * interface.  Also note that configuration change related to the log file
068 * (e.g., the log file path, buffer size, queue size, etc.) will also
069 * automatically be handled by the server, so subclasses only need to be
070 * concerned about changes to the custom arguments they define.
071 * <BR>
072 * <H2>Configuring File-Based Error Loggers</H2>
073 * In order to configure an error logger created using this API, use a command
074 * like:
075 * <PRE>
076 *      dsconfig create-log-publisher \
077 *           --publisher-name "<I>{logger-name}</I>" \
078 *           --type groovy-scripted-file-based-error \
079 *           --set enabled:true \
080 *           --set "log-file:<I>{path}</I>" \
081 *           --set "rotation-policy:<I>{rotation-policy-name}</I>" \
082 *           --set "retention-policy:<I>{retention-policy-name}</I>" \
083 *           --set "script-class:<I>{class-name}</I>" \
084 *           --set "script-argument:<I>{name=value}</I>"
085 * </PRE>
086 * where "<I>{logger-name}</I>" is the name to use for the error logger
087 * instance, "<I>{path}</I>" is the path to the log file to be written,
088 * "<I>{rotation-policy-name}</I>" is the name of the log rotation policy to use
089 * for the log file, "<I>{retention-policy-name}</I>" is the name of the log
090 * retention policy to use for the log file, "<I>{class-name}</I>" is the
091 * fully-qualified name of the Groovy class written using this API, and
092 * "<I>{name=value}</I>" represents name-value pairs for any arguments to
093 * provide to the logger.  If multiple arguments should be provided to the
094 * logger, then the "<CODE>--set script-argument:<I>{name=value}</I></CODE>"
095 * option should be provided multiple times.  It is also possible to specify
096 * multiple log rotation and/or retention policies if desired.
097 *
